FAQ
What is Sagase?
Sagase is a Japanese-English dictionary and learning application designed to help users explore and master the Japanese language. It provides extensive vocabulary and kanji information, along with tools like flashcards for effective study.
How many words and kanji does Sagase contain?
Sagase features over 200,000 vocabulary entries and more than 13,000 kanji. This extensive database supports comprehensive language exploration and learning.
Can I search for Japanese words using different scripts in Sagase?
Yes, Sagase allows you to search using romaji, kana, and kanji. It also includes handwriting recognition for finding characters.
Does Sagase offer flashcards for learning?
Yes, Sagase includes smart flashcards with spaced repetition and random order settings. You can customize front displays and track performance insights.
What types of kanji lists are available in Sagase?
Sagase provides lists for JLPT vocab and kanji, Jouyou, Jinmeiyou, grade school kanji, Kanji Kentei, and kanji radicals.
Is Sagase available on multiple devices?
Sagase is supported on iPhone, iPad, and iPod devices, making it accessible for users across Apple's mobile ecosystem.
